O'Loghlen baronets

The O'Loghlen Baronetcy, of Drumcanora in Ennis was created on 16 July 1838[1] for the prominent Irish judge and Whig politician Michael O'Loghlen.

The second Baronet represented County Clare in the House of Commons as a Liberal from 1863 to 1877.

The third Baronet emigrated to Australia and served as Premier of Victoria from 1881 to 1883.

The fourth Baronet was Lord-Lieutenant of County Clare between 1910 and 1922.
